Lakatan Bananas in Cagayan de Oro City


A month ago, I started planting Lakatan bananas from suckers I bought from Brod Dodo who has a lakatan farm in Kinoguitan. Planting lakatan bananas is not so easy involving not just land preparation which I did in the most haphazard way but also deciding how many plants you would want in your farm.

I decided it would be best to have a good enough density like 2,100 plants per hectare and computing from that I came up with a scheme of planting each sucker 215 cm. from each other. I think this is a pretty good number. The traditional way is to plant each sucker three meters apart which would result in a density of less than 1000 plants per hectare.

The Night Cafe in Cagayan de Oro City

The Night Cafe seems to have become a permanent fixture in Cagayan de Oro City and merchants ad hawkers as no longer content to show their wares on Friday and Saturday as the designated dates; but they seem to have them at the Divisoria on other days as well. This has come to be accepted by the people of Cagayan de Oro as well who seem to appreciate the fiesta atmosphere of wares being displayed on the streets.

I used to think that the Night Cafe was a big nuisance and that it served very little purpose at all. I could be wrong and the fact that more and more sellers and buyers come to meet on weekends to conduct commerce seems to suggest that this is something that benefits many people. Certainly Cagayan de Oro City has changed in more ways than one. Like or not, the Night Cafe seems to indicate an ever-increasing presence in the lives of the folks of Cagayan de Oro City.
